Temperature rise in a water pump working at normal conditions with flow 6 m3/h (0.0017 m3/s), brake power 0.11 kW and pump efficiency of 28% (0.28) can be calculated as. dt = (0.11 kW) (1 - 0.28) / ( (4.2 kJ/kgoC) (0.0017 m3/s) (1000
